Tascam 112 MKii 90's - 00's Stereo Cassette Recorder - 240V The Tascam 112 mkII is a stereo cassette deck with Dolby B/C and HX-Pro noise reduction, it was first sold by Tascam in 1994 with a list price of USD $1,200 and discontinued 12 years later in 2006. It features 2 heads, digital linear tape counter with 4 digits, tape type selection and capable of handling normal, chrome and metal tapes, a belt driven single-capstan transport, analog needle VU reading meters, full-logic transport controls, fast and effortless transport function selection, the playback speed may be adjusted with pitch control and cue and review can be used to easily and quickly locate the beginning of a passage. For undisturbed listening a jack connector for a pair of stereo headphones is supplied.
